Description

Communal appellation of the Côte de Nuits district (dept. of Côte-d’Or). The name Vougeot immediately calls up the name of that famous vineyard, the Clos de Vougeot. But this village of the Côte de Nuits has other fine vineyards. The name itself derives from that of the little river Vouge. The powerful abbey of Cîteaux established these vineyards in the 12th century and laid the foundations of their long, brilliant reputation. The appellation was formally instituted in 1936.

Terroir

The vines grow at altitudes between 240 and 280 meters. Those on the upper slopes occupy shallow brown limestone soils. The soils on the lower slopes are limestones, fine-textured marls, and clays. These plots lie very close to the northern part of the Clos de Vougeot.

Harvest

Handpicked harvest.

Vinification

Traditional fermentation in oak barrels (20-25% new oak).

Ageing

Maturation during 20 months in cellar for aging, stored in barrels.

Tasting Notes

Aromas of mayflower, acacia, and honeysuckle blend with verbena and hazelnut. This wine boasts a profound minerality (flint). Age brings in notes of honey or ripe pear. Its attack is instantaneous. On the palate, fleshiness is matched by mellowness, and both are equally persistent

Food Pairing

Ideal partner for delicate fine white meats such as poultry or veal in sauce. Fish, either in well-spiced couscous or in Asian dishes such as curries or stir-fries, are also well-suited. Salmon, in itself highly aromatic, harmonizes particularly well. It will readily complement crawfish, lobster, or even cooked fattened goose liver (foie gras).
